From 0fef0a87330b5027a899888d56b517d0eddb980d Mon Sep 17 00:00:00 2001 From: Jason Peters Date: Sat, 3 Feb 2024 21:54:19 +0100 Subject: [PATCH] =?UTF-8?q?Begr=C3=BC=C3=9Fung=20und=20Eingabe=20f=C3=BCr?= =?UTF-8?q?=20Rakete?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/main/c/Jason/ASCII_art.c | 21 +++++++++++++++++++++ src/main/c/Jason/ASCII_art.h | 1 + 2 files changed, 22 insertions(+) diff --git a/src/main/c/Jason/ASCII_art.c b/src/main/c/Jason/ASCII_art.c index f083cf6..652ef55 100644 --- a/src/main/c/Jason/ASCII_art.c +++ b/src/main/c/Jason/ASCII_art.c @@ -75,6 +75,19 @@ void dreieck(){ } void rakete(){ + raketeBegruessung(); + int hoehe; + do{ + scanf("%d", &hoehe); + if(hoehe < 3){ + printf("Es wurde ein Wert eingegeben, der kleiner ist als 3. Bitte geben Sie erneut eine Zahl ein!\n" + "Eingbe:"); + } + } while(hoehe < 3); + + + + } @@ -287,3 +300,11 @@ void befuellenDesDreiecksMitZeilenumbruechen(char arr[], int gesamtzeilen, int a arr[arraygroesse] = '\0'; } + +void raketeBegruessung(){ + + printf("Sie haben die ASCII-Art Rakete ausgewählt ! Bitte Geben Sie ein wie hoch die Rakete sein soll\n" + "(Mindestens 3)\n" + "Eingabe:"); + +} \ No newline at end of file diff --git a/src/main/c/Jason/ASCII_art.h b/src/main/c/Jason/ASCII_art.h index a8e8538..d06c1a1 100644 --- a/src/main/c/Jason/ASCII_art.h +++ b/src/main/c/Jason/ASCII_art.h @@ -25,5 +25,6 @@ int berechnungDerDreieckArraygroesse(int); void befuellenDesDreiecksMitX(char[], int); void befuellenDesDreiecksMitZeilenumbruechen(char[], int, int); void rakete(); +void raketeBegruessung(); #endif